Due to its characteristics of pore size, surface area, percentage of covering (%C), and the kind of silica it is build of, it is the suitable alternative to Hypersil ODS packings. Its chromatographic behavior exactly reproduces the one of this popular packing, being able to transfer the chromatographic methods without any kind of adjustment.
| Vendor | Teknokroma | Length | |
| Brand | Hyperpack BASIC ODS | Internal Diameter | |
| Modifification | Silica/C18 | Pore size | 130 |
| Mode | Reversed-Phase | Surface Area | 170 |
| Particle Size | Carbon Load, % | 11.0 |
